  4. 4. Noctilucent clouds in a coupled atmosphere

    Author : Bodil Karlsson; Peter Sigray; Jacek Stegman; Scott Bailey; Stockholms universitet; []
    Keywords : NATURVETENSKAP; NATURAL SCIENCES; Noctilucent clouds; atmospheric dynamics; Meteorology; Meteorologi; atmosfärvetenskap; Atmospheric Sciences;

    Abstract : Noctilucent clouds (NLC) at altitudes around 80 km are the highest clouds in our atmosphere. They have been a subject of research ever since their discovery in the late 19th century. This thesis takes an important step towards using NLC as a tool for studying dynamic coupling processes in the atmosphere on a global scale. READ MORE

  5. 5. Studies of planetary waves in ozone and temperature fields as observed by the Odin satellite in 2002-2007

    Author : Alla Belova; Sheila Kirkwood; Andrew Klekociuk; Umeå universitet; []
    Keywords : NATURVETENSKAP; NATURAL SCIENCES; middle atmosphere dynamics; planetary waves; 5-day planetary wave; temperature-ozone relationship; Odin satellite; Atmosphere and hydrosphere sciences; Atmosfärs- och hydrosfärsvetenskap;

    Abstract : The results presented in this PhD thesis are mainly based on measurements collected by the advanced sub-mm radiometer (SMR) aboard the Odin satellite in 2002-2007. The primary data are series of temperature and ozone profiles in the middle atmosphere up to 68 km. READ MORE
